What is one of the responsibilities of a seller-server during their shift?

One of the key responsibilities of a seller-server during their shift is to ensure compliance with alcohol service regulations. This involves understanding and following the laws and guidelines set by local, state, and federal authorities regarding the sale and service of alcoholic beverages. Adhering to these regulations is vital to promote safe drinking practices, prevent underage drinking, and avoid over-serving intoxicated individuals. By focusing on compliance, seller-servers help maintain a responsible drinking environment and uphold the integrity of the establishment.

The other options present practices that do not align with responsible service. Serving only regular customers might imply discrimination or favoritism, while serving customers without restrictions could lead to irresponsible behavior and potential legal issues. Prioritizing profit over safety contradicts the fundamental principles of responsible alcohol service, which emphasize customer well-being and compliance with the law.
